ToolBar.java
import java.awt.*; import java.awt.geom.*; import java.util.*; import javax.swing.*; /** A tool bar that contains node and edge prototype icons. Exactly one icon is selected at any time. */ public class ToolBar extends JPanel { /** Constructs a tool bar with no icons. */ public ToolBar(Graph graph) { group = new ButtonGroup(); tools = new ArrayList(); JToggleButton grabberButton = new JToggleButton(new Icon() { public int getIconHeight() { return BUTTON_SIZE; } public int getIconWidth() { return BUTTON_SIZE; } public void paintIcon(Component c, Graphics g, int x, int y) { Graphics2D g2 = (Graphics2D) g; GraphPanel.drawGrabber(g2, x + OFFSET, y + OFFSET); GraphPanel.drawGrabber(g2, x + OFFSET, y + BUTTON_SIZE - OFFSET); GraphPanel.drawGrabber(g2, x + BUTTON_SIZE - OFFSET, y + OFFSET); GraphPanel.drawGrabber(g2, x + BUTTON_SIZE - OFFSET, y + BUTTON_SIZE - OFFSET); } }); group.add(grabberButton); add(grabberButton); grabberButton.setSelected(true); tools.add(null); Node[] nodeTypes = graph.getNodePrototypes(); for (int i = 0; i < nodeTypes.length; i++) add(nodeTypes[i]); Edge[] edgeTypes = graph.getEdgePrototypes(); for (int i = 0; i < edgeTypes.length; i++) add(edgeTypes[i]); } /** Gets the node or edge prototype that is associated with the currently selected button @return a Node or Edge prototype */ public Object getSelectedTool() { for (int i = 0; i < tools.size(); i++) { JToggleButton button = (JToggleButton) getComponent(i); if (button.isSelected()) return tools.get(i); } return null; } /** Adds a node to the tool bar. @param n the node to add */ public void add(final Node n) { JToggleButton button = new JToggleButton(new Icon() { public int getIconHeight() { return BUTTON_SIZE; } public int getIconWidth() { return BUTTON_SIZE; } public void paintIcon(Component c, Graphics g, int x, int y) { double width = n.getBounds().getWidth(); double height = n.getBounds().getHeight(); Graphics2D g2 = (Graphics2D) g; double scaleX = (BUTTON_SIZE - OFFSET)/ width; double scaleY = (BUTTON_SIZE - OFFSET)/ height; double scale = Math.min(scaleX, scaleY); AffineTransform oldTransform = g2.getTransform(); g2.translate(x, y); g2.scale(scale, scale); g2.translate(Math.max((height - width) / 2, 0), Math.max((width - height) / 2, 0)); g2.setColor(Color.black); n.draw(g2); g2.setTransform(oldTransform); } }); group.add(button); add(button); tools.add(n); } /** Adds an edge to the tool bar. @param n the edge to add */ public void add(final Edge e) { JToggleButton button = new JToggleButton(new Icon() { public int getIconHeight() { return BUTTON_SIZE; } public int getIconWidth() { return BUTTON_SIZE; } public void paintIcon(Component c, Graphics g, int x, int y) { Graphics2D g2 = (Graphics2D) g; PointNode p = new PointNode(); p.translate(OFFSET, OFFSET); PointNode q = new PointNode(); q.translate(BUTTON_SIZE - OFFSET, BUTTON_SIZE - OFFSET); e.connect(p, q); g2.translate(x, y); g2.setColor(Color.black); e.draw(g2); g2.translate(-x, -y); } }); group.add(button); add(button); tools.add(e); } private ButtonGroup group; private ArrayList tools; private static final int BUTTON_SIZE = 25; private static final int OFFSET = 4; }
